DISCIPLINE HEALTH
Health as a lifestyle involves adopting habits and behaviors that promote physical, mental, and emotional well-being consistently and sustainably, in a disciplined manner, and these three dimensions of health are interconnected and mutually influence each other in various ways.

It is the well-being of the body and its ability to function optimally. This includes aspects such as:
- Balanced nutrition.
- Regular physical activity.
- Adequate rest.
- The prevention of diseases and injuries.
Promoting physical health involves adopting a healthy lifestyle that includes a balanced diet, regular exercise, avoiding harmful substances, and undergoing regular medical check-ups.

It is the ability to recognize, understand, and manage our emotions constructively. It involves:
- To be aware of our own emotions.
- Express them appropriately.
- Establish healthy relationships with others.
Promoting emotional health involves fostering emotional intelligence skills, such as empathy, stress management, conflict resolution, and seeking support when necessary.
